Most clubs select new members through interviews and internships, and organize members to carry out a variety of activities, such as photography training, calligraphy and painting exhibitions, keynote speeches, news gathering, newspapers and periodicals sorting, sports competitions, etc. This provides various opportunities for cultivating students' practical ability.

Experience in editing newspapers

A Chinese department student said: "I used to see my roommates join the press corps. In order to edit the newspaper, I got up early and got greedy, which took up a lot of time, and I secretly rejoiced that I had more study time than them." But when the teacher assigned homework and asked each student to do the newspaper layout, I panicked! Because I can't do anything, they are easy to get, thinking about how to innovate the style. "
